Double Standards

Re: Obama’s demand that Americans for Prosperity release its list of donors — didn’t Alabama try that with the NAACP in the 1950s? Legally, of course, the cases are different, because Alabama subpoenaed the NAACP’s membership lists. But what’s the difference in principle? And does anyone believe that Eric Holder’s Justice Department hasn’t at least considered the idea of subpoenaing AFP’s membership list? Because, you know, some political organizations are more equal than others.
